461cc5c003 Cleanup GPL header address notices by using http://www.gnu.org/licenses/
Sync VEX/LICENSE.GPL with top-level COPYING file. We used 3 different
addresses for writing to the FSF to receive a copy of the GPL. Replace
all different variants with an URL <http://www.gnu.org/licenses/>.

The following files might still have some slightly different (L)GPL
copyright notice because they were derived from other programs:

ab40e94dad drd: Fix a race condition in the barrier implementation that could result in false positives.
What could occur before this fix is:
- The pthread_barrier() call in a first thread finishes.
- Another thread invokes pthread_join() on that thread, causing the information
  associated with that thread to be removed from the barrier object.
- The pthread_barrier() call in another thread finishes. Because some
  thread information has already been removed from the barrier object, the
  per-thread vector clock "last" won't be computed correctly by
  DRD_(barrier_post_wait)().
- Because of the above false positives could be reported.

This resulted in sporadic failure of the drd/tests/matinv regression test, and
should now be fixed.

e5f5573f88 Changes:
- Generalized the behavior of happens-before / happens-after annotations such
  that not only 1:1 but also n:m patterns are supported.
- Dropped support for invoking happens-before / happens-after annotations on
  POSIX condition variables (pthread_cond_t).
- Report the details about the offending synchronization object in generic
  errors.
- Converted a few tl_assert() statements into error messages.
